22 April: International Mother Earth Day

The International Mother Earth Day, celebrated annually on 22 April since 1970, is a stark reminder of the urgent need to protect our environment. It is a global call to action that challenges individuals around the world to take responsibility for protecting our planet and its resources for future generations.

On this Mother Earth Day, people from all corners of the world participate in various activities such as tree planting, clean-up initiatives and educational events aimed at raising awareness about environmental issues. It is a day full of collective efforts to make a positive impact on our world.
